About mod:

The Manure System mod changes the whole Gameplay around handling your manure application. Experience what it really means to pump liquids as a real farmer. Use the fill arms to actually be able to pump from open sources like: manure containers, lagoons amd water sources. Use a specialized dock arm in order to suck from a docking funnel, or simply use a suction hose. With a suction hose you´re able to pump a liquid fill type from source to target. If applicable you could extend the liquid manure hose to reach larger ranges. Pumping does not always happen at full efficiency, manure thickness decreases the pump capacity and also the length of hoses affects your pump time. All vanilla vehicles are supported (and some have additional changes), for a full list please check the manual below.

How do I install Farming Simulator mods?
Find a mod that you like and want to download first. Then, on your PC, download a mod. Mods are typically in.zip format. However, it is sometimes in.rar format. If the mod file is in.zip format, no additional actions are required. If a file is in.rar format, you must unarchive it using software such as WinRar or Zip7. Windows 10 users do not need to use archive software; Win10 includes an unarchive feature.

The next step is to locate the mods folder on your computer. It is typically found in Documents/My Games/Farming Simulator [Your FS game version, e.g. 2022]. Open the "mods" folder and place the downloaded.zip archive or unarchived.rar file there.
